The Role of State Medical Boards
State medical boards are the main authorities accountable for approving the right to practice medicine. They exist to secure the general public by guaranteeing that every licensed doctor satisfies particular standards of education, training, and ethical conduct.

For many physicians, the "finest location" to start the licensing procedure is not a single state, however rather through the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C). The IMLC is an agreement between taking part U.S. states and areas to streamline the licensing process for physicians who wish to practice in numerous states.

Federation of State Medical Boards (FSMB) and FCVS
The FSMB provides a service called the Federation Credentials Verification Service (FCVS). This is a permanent repository of a doctor's core qualifications.

The financial dedication to a medical license does not end with the preliminary "purchase." Licenses must be renewed, typically every two years.

5. Does a license in one state allow practice in another?
Usually, no. A doctor must hold a license in the particular state where the client is situated. However, some states enable restricted practice for a few days under particular circumstances, and the IMLC makes it easier to hold multiple individual state licenses all at once.
